Given Input Data is 580, 103, 58, 573
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 580 is 2 x 2 x 5 x 29
Prime Factorization of 103 is 103
Prime Factorization of 58 is 2 x 29
Prime Factorization of 573 is 3 x 191
The above numbers do not have any common prime factor. So GCD is 1
